Pavement sealing is a process that invol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and walkways. This coating acts as a barrier against elements like water, oil, and UV rays, helping to preserve the integrity of the pavement. The service typically includes cleaning the surface th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and oil stains, followed by applying the sealant in even layers to ensure full coverage. Proper sealing can enhance the appearance of the pavement while providing an extra layer of protection against common sources of damage.
Sealing asphalt can help address several common problems that occur over time. Without protection, pavements are vulnerable to cracking, surface deterioration, and the formation of potholes, especially in climates with frequent freeze-thaw cycles. The sealant minimizes the impact of moisture infiltration, which is a leading cause of pavement damage. It also prevents the penetration of oil and chemicals that can break down the asphalt binder. Regular sealing can extend the lifespan of the pavement, reducing the need for costly repairs or replacement in the future.

The overview below groups typical Pavement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odinville,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or sealing jobs on driveways or walkways in Woodinville range from $250-$600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, depending on surface size and condition.
Medium-Sized Projects - Larger driveway sealing or multiple surface areas can c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for residential properties seeking comprehensive pavement protection.
Commercial or Large-Scale Jobs - Sealing extensive parking lots or multiple surfaces often ranges from $1,500-$5,000+.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which are typically more complex or require additional surface preparation.
Full Replacement or Major Overhaul - Complete pavement replacement or extensive surface repairs can exceed $5,000+, though these are less frequent and depend on the project's scope and surface condition.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
